What Is the Difference Between Blood Thinners and Blood Pressure Meds?

Understanding Blood Thinners

Blood thinners — the medical term is anticoagulants — are medications that make your blood less likely to form clots. Because of that, they don't actually thin your blood in the literal sense. What they do is interfere with the clotting cascade, which is the chain reaction your body uses to seal a wound or, unfortunately, to form a dangerous clot inside a vein or artery That alone is useful..

Common blood thinners include:

  • Warfarin (Coumadin) — one of the oldest and most well-known
  • Heparin — often used in hospital settings
  • Apixaban (Eliquis) — a newer direct oral anticoagulant
  • Rivaroxaban (Xarelto) — another popular DOAC
  • Dabigatran (Pradaxa) — yet another newer option

These drugs work by blocking specific clotting factors or enzymes in your blood. Day to day, that's it. Their job is to prevent strokes, pulmonary embolisms, deep vein thrombosis, and other clot-related events No workaround needed..

Understanding Blood Pressure Medications

Blood pressure medications — or antihypertensives — do something entirely different. They target your blood vessels, your heart, or your kidneys to reduce the force of blood pushing against your artery walls. There are many classes of these drugs:

  • ACE inhibitors like lisinopril
  • Beta-blockers like metoprolol
  • Calcium channel blockers like amlodipine
  • Diuretics like hydrochlorothiazide
  • Angiotensin II receptor blockers (ARBs) like losartan

Each one works through a different mechanism, but they all share the same goal: get your blood pressure into a safer range.

Why Does This Question Come Up So Often?

Overlapping Conditions

The reason this question gets asked so much is that the people who need blood thinners are often the same people who have high blood pressure. In real terms, atrial fibrillation, for example, is an irregular heartbeat that increases stroke risk — and it's frequently managed with both a blood thinner and a blood pressure medication. Heart failure patients might be on multiple drugs that address different aspects of their condition Worth knowing..

So when someone is on a blood thinner and also has high blood pressure, it's easy to assume the blood thinner is helping with the pressure too. It's not. It's just treating a different problem entirely.

How Blood Thinners Actually Affect Your Circulatory System

The Clot Prevention Mechanism

Let's get into the mechanics a bit. When you take a blood thinner, it reduces your blood's ability to clot by inhibiting specific proteins or enzymes. Warfarin, for instance, blocks vitamin K-dependent clotting factors. In practice, dOACs like apixaban target a specific enzyme called thrombin or factor Xa. None of these actions change how much pressure your blood exerts on your artery walls And it works..

Indirect Effects — What's Real and What's Not

Could a blood thinner have any indirect effect on blood pressure? In very rare and specific situations, maybe a tiny one — but we're talking negligible. Here's what I mean:

  • Improved blood flow: If you had a clot partially blocking a vessel, and the blood thinner dissolves or prevents it from growing, blood flow through that vessel improves. That could theoretically lower local resistance, but it's not the same as lowering systemic blood pressure.
  • Reduced inflammation: Some research suggests certain anticoagulants have mild anti-inflammatory properties. Chronic inflammation can contribute to vascular damage, so in the very long term, there might be a minor indirect benefit. But this is not a blood pressure–lowering effect in any clinically meaningful sense.

Mixing Over-the-Counter Meds Without Checking

This one catches people off guard constantly. NSAIDs like ibuprofen and naproxen can raise blood pressure and interfere with the effectiveness of certain blood thinners. Some cold medications contain decongestants like pseudoephedrine that constrict blood vessels and push blood pressure higher. Even herbal supplements — garlic, ginkgo, ginseng — can interact with anticoagulants Which is the point..

Always check with your pharmacist or doctor before combining any new over-the-counter product with your prescription medications.

Adopt Lifestyle Changes That Actually Move the Needle

Medication works best when it's supported by real lifestyle adjustments. These aren't just nice-to-haves — they can meaningfully reduce your blood pressure:

  • Reduce sodium intake — aim for less than 2,300 mg per day, ideally closer to 1,500 mg if you're hypertensive.
  • Increase potassium-rich foods — bananas, spinach, sweet potatoes, and avocados help counterbalance sodium's effects.
  • Exercise regularly — even 30 minutes of moderate walking most days can lower systolic blood pressure by 5 to 8 mmHg.
  • Limit alcohol consumption — excessive drinking raises blood pressure and can interfere with both blood thinners and blood pressure medications.
  • Manage stress — chronic stress contributes to sustained hypertension. Techniques like deep breathing, meditation, and adequate sleep are not trivial interventions.
